Transaction 42167201456862eea11cc59b0d70e94a69a6639f776ff8210205df10730ce59e

4 Input
2 Outputs
  • 42167201456862eea11cc59b0d70e94a69a6639f776ff8210205df10730ce59e:0
  • value  1000515
    address  n2Fc1T5W5bZ8x1txnu887fpQLMKfFsaU1u
  • 42167201456862eea11cc59b0d70e94a69a6639f776ff8210205df10730ce59e:1
  • value  1656957
    address  mz7dc4UqEmmekLuDQcb6PCngFLHKhYAsQ4